Turkish General Staff to recall military from vacation

YEREVAN, JULY 27, ARMENPRESS: General Staff of the Turkish Armed Forces recalled from vacation the staff of 2nd and 3rd Field Army, stationed in the south-east of the country, due to the worsening situation on the border with Syria, Hurriyet reported.

Armenpress reports that the order also applies to personnel departments involved in combating terrorism in other parts of the country.

The situation in Turkey in recent days is very tense.

According to the Turkish military, earlier on Thursday five IS militants fired with with rocket-propelled grenades and Kalashnikov rifles on border patrol in the province of Kilis. As a result of attack the one soldier died and two were wounded.

Earlier this week, a powerful explosion occurred in Suruc city on the border with Syria. 32 people died and about 100 were injured. The attack has been widely blamed on Daesh by Turkish officials.
